Abstract
This work analyzes stories of babassu coconut breaker s women in Maranhão, in referring to
social representations, labor relations, gender and maternalism, identity construction,
agricultural and environmental problems, models and mechanisms of organization and
formation of social movement. This work is divided into basic and supplementary axes of
research.It highlights the importance of a domestic economy of babassu supported in female
work, analyzing the social representations of this natural resource and highlighting the
invisibility of peasants in face of dominant sectors. It analyzes gender relations and work, and
the uses of time between peasants involved with agriculture and the breaking of coconut in
Maranhão, pointing to signs of maternalism in the discourses and practices of coconut
breakers. It also discusses the experiences of coconut breakers that with or without the
participation of other agents and groups, constructed collective identities and developed
mobilization strategies and forms of resistance in the context of conflicts and struggles over
land and access and preservation to babaçu palm. And, it observes also the process of
construction of coconut breaker s identity and other identities related to it ( woman , black ,
maroon , indigenous , etc.), analyzing changes and achievements in the trajectory of
women after their insertion in MIQCB, including the expansion of their autonomy and the
construction of ideals of gender equality.
